The Tarantula Spider only spawns in Animal Crossing New Horizons after 7 pm. Once 7 pm hits, the player has the chance to run into the spider in the wild. They are pretty rare to spawn so make sure to capture them when they appear. They also rush at the player at high speeds and can knock them out with an attack. Aiming the net and timing it just right is the only way to capture this creature. Despite on the main island, the spider only spawns so often. How To Infinitely Spawn Tarantula Spiders in Animal Crossing New Horizons

For starters, the player must purchase a Nook Miles Tour Ticket from Tom Nook's tent. This item allows players to transport to another tropical island to explore it and reap all of its benefits. While this does contain potential ethical connotations, it is the only way to spawn infinite Tarantula Spiders. Before heading onto the island, make sure to bring all of these required tools.

  • Shovel
  • Ladder
  • Vaulting Pole
  • Net
  • Ax

Also, this only works for the Northern Hemisphere of the game from November - April. At the start of the game, it requires the player to select what part of the world they are from. This changes the types of spawns players will find throughout the year. For example, Sharks are typically only found at this time of the year for the Southern Hemisphere. Players can also time skip by changing the date on the Nintendo Switch forward to April. Now that the player has all of there tools, they must destroy the entire island. This is how players can do this.

  • Chop down all of the trees using an ax.
  • Remove all of the stumps using a shovel.
  • This only works past 7 pm as this is when the spiders spawn.
  • Pick up all of the flowers. Players are not required to uproot them, only pick them.
  • Capture all of the bugs or scare them all away.

Using the ladder, players can access the higher points of the island and remove the resources from there. All resources need to be removed for this to work. Once this is done, throw all of the resources into the water at the beach to clear the player's inventory. Tarantula Spiders will begin to spawn around the island. Fortunately, getting attacked by Tarantula Spider only places the player at the beginning of the island rather than sending them home, so there is no real risk from doing this method. Using the net, capture as many Spiders as needed and head back to the main island. Here, the Tarantula will sell for 8,000 Bells per spider, making this an easy way to raise money quickly.
